Matvey Olikheyko

2×2 · top 3.4% of 186,767 all-time · competing since August 2016 · 2016OLIK01

Matvey Olikheyko has been competing for 10 years. His best event is the 2×2: a personal-best single of 1.76, set at To The Moon 2017, puts him in the top 3.4% of the 186,767 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 110th in Russia. Until February 2008, no official 2×2 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 8 competitions since August 2016, he has put 361 official solves on the record across twelve events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 16% around a typical one; 90%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ds hold a tighter spread. His Skewb best has come down from 5.88 in August 2016 to 3.42, a 42% improvement. Matvey has entered eight competitions, more competitions than 90% of everyone who has ever competed.
